FLOGGINGS ORDERED
(Press. Assn.-
STERN MEASURES TO CHECK ROBBERY WITH VIOLENCE
— By Telegraph— Copyright) .
Rec. July 12, 7.0 p.m. LONDON, Tuesday. Judges are increasingly ordering the cat for robbery and violence. Three men were sentenced at the Winchester Assizes to five, four and three years respectively and 15 strokes each with the cat for robbery of £62,347 in May last. At Old Bailey, twp men were tried in connection with an attack on a eashier at Stratford and were ordered 12 strokes of the cat in addition to a term of imprisonment.
